Troubleshooting Viron Pool Chlorinator Cells: Common Issues & Solutions
Dealing with a malfunctioning Viron pool chlorinator unit can be frustrating, but many issues are relatively straightforward to resolve . Common setbacks often stem from scaling, low chlorine levels, or a faulty energy supply. One frequent complaint is reduced chlorination; this could be caused by calcium buildup β try descaling the cell with a dedicated descaling product following the manufacturer's instructions . Alternatively, check your salt amount; a measurement that's too excessive or too low can impact cell operation . Examine the cell's wiring and links to ensure a secure attachment ; a loose conductor can interrupt power. If the issue persists after these steps , it's recommended to consult a qualified pool expert for further assessment or consider cell substitution .
- Scaling: Descale with a specific solution.
- Salt Level: Check and adjust salt concentration.
- Power Supply: Inspect wiring and connections.
